  • COPPER(I) IODIDE ASSISTED REACTION OF NONACTIVATED IODOARENES WITH SODIUM TRIFLUOROACETATE IN HEXAMETHYLPHOSPHORIC TRIAMIDE. NUCLEAR TRIFLUOROMETHYLATION AND DIARYL ETHER FORMATION
    作者:Hitomi Suzuki、Yoshiki Yoshida、Atsuhiro Osuka
    DOI:10.1246/cl.1982.135
    日期:1982.1.5
    Polymethyliodobenzenes react with sodium trifluoroacetate, in tine presence of copper(I) iodide, in hexamethylphosphoric triamide at 150–180°C, giving a mixture of the corresponding polymethylbenzotrifluoride, parent hydrocarbon, and bis(polymethylphenyl) ether.
    聚甲基碘苯与三氟乙酸钠在碘化铜 (I) 存在下,在六甲基磷三酰胺中于 150–180°C 反应,生成相应的聚甲基三氟苯、母烃和双(聚甲基苯基)醚的混合物。
